What should the Idaho Legislature do when someone’s testimony is offensive? That’s what lawmakers grappled with Monday when a local conservative provocateur came to testify on an immigration bill wearing brownface and a sombrero and speaking Spanish. As David Pettinger began speaking, Rep. Steve Berch, D-Boise, cut him off. He signaled to the House Business Committee’s acting chair, Rep. Josh …
